The National Monuments Service's description
In upland area where forest has been felled. Not marked on 1841 edition of the OS 6-inch map but appears on 1888 and 1910 editions As a subcircular enclosure (max. diam. c. 30m N-S). Not located, but appears to have been destroyed by afforestation.
The above description is derived from the published 'Archaeological Inventory of County Laois' (Dublin Stationery Office, 1995) compiled by P. David Sweetman, Olive Alcock and Bernie Moran. In certain instances the entries have been revised and updated in the light of recent research.
